There is a key difference between being alone and feeling lonely.(18)"Alone" is a state of being by oneself without others around, and can actually be a healthy phenomenon. Everyone needs a little time away from others to plan, consider, and simply to rest. Loneliness is a different matter entirely.
While it’s normal to feel lonely or isolated from time to time, too much loneliness can be unhealthy or even dangerous.
The good news is, loneliness is a condition that can be fought against and overcome! For example, you can take a walk. This may seem confusing, but walking has been proven to offer many great health benefits both for the body and the mind.(19)Any form of exercise would do as well, but walking is better because it allows people to explore their town or the area around them in a way a car simply does not allow. While walking, take a different route than you usually would to get to a usual goal point. Even better, simply pick a direction at random and start.(20)Just the feeling of walking down the street, surrounded by traffic and other people, can make you feel more involved in the pulse of your city or town. Besides, you may discover something new you didn’t know your town had to offer!
